연구실 소개

정희태 교수의 연구실은 2차원 물질을 활용한 고감도 센서 기술 개발에 주력하고 있습니다. 그래핀, MoS₂, MXene, 블랙 풀리늄 등 다양한 2차원 나노소재를 활용해 바이오의학 진단과 환경 모니터링에 응용 가능한 기술을 연구하고 있으며, 특히 병원성 가스 및 락틴산 농도를 초고감도로 감지할 수 있는 센서 시스템을 개발하고 있습니다. 또한, 표면 기능화와 다층 구조 설계를 통해 선택성과 반응 속도를 향상시키는 기초 연구도 진행 중입니다.

Layer-by-layer assembly of graphene and gold nanoparticles by vacuum filtration and spontaneous reduction of gold ions
Byung‐Seon Kong, Jianxin Geng, Hee‐Tae Jung
SJR Q1Chemical Communications

Layer-by-layer films comprised of alternating graphene and gold nanoparticle layers are readily produced by the two-step procedure involving the use of vacuum filtration of a reduced graphene oxide solution to fabricate the graphene thin film on the quartz substrate, followed by gold nanoparticle formation by spontaneous reduction of gold ions in a gold salt solution on the graphene films.

The origins of stability of spontaneous vesicles
Hee‐Tae Jung, Bret A. Coldren, J. A. Zasadzinski, D. J. Iampietro, E. W. Kaler
SJR Q1Proceedings of the National Academy of SciencesOA

Equilibrium unilamellar vesicles are stabilized by one of two distinct mechanisms depending on the value of the bending constant. Helfrich undulations ensure that the interbilayer potential is always repulsive when the bending constant, K, is of order k(B)T. When K k(B)T, unilamellar vesicles are stabilized by the spontaneous curvature that picks out a particular vesicle radius; other radii are disfavored energetically.
